Jan and Dean were an American rock duo consisting of William Jan Berryand Dean Ormsby Torrence. In the early 1960s, they were pioneers of the California Sound and vocal surf music styles popularized by the Beach Boys. Among their most successful songs was "Surf City", which topped US record charts in 1963, the first surf song to do so. For the last year and a half, I'm actually really enjoying myself on stage, ... Before I was happy we could please the fans, but I was always looking out of the corner of my eye, trying to keep track of Jan -- making sure that he wasn't getting up and going someplace that he shouldn't or worrying that he's going to trip over something and hurt himself.
